Hotel Details

Domes Resort Santorini

Imerovigli Santorini
room photo
Search Details
  • Check in:
  • Check out:
  • Occupant(s):
Popular amenities

This comfortable hotel is in Imerovigli. Pets are not allowed at Domes Resort Santorini.